A simple agreement for future equity delays valuation of a company until it has more performance data on which to base a valuation. At the same time, it promises an investor the right to buy future equity when a valuation is made. A SAFE can be converted into preferred stock in the future.
Cons: SAFE investors assume most, if not all, of the risk, in that there is no guarantee of any equity ownership in the company. ... A SAFE holder is not entitled to any company assets in the event of a liquidation.
A Simple Agreement for Future Equity (SAFE) is a contractual agreement between a startup company and its investors. It exchanges the investor's investment for the right to preferred shares in the startup company when the company raises a future round of funding.
